addd Bulwark wireguard

This commit is contained in:
Tyler Starr 2023-10-08 10:29:38 -07:00
parent bbbcc13cc1
commit 4f850e9a3a

View File

@ -53,7 +53,7 @@
# Define user account. # Define user account.
users.users.${user} = { users.users.${user} = {
isNormalUser = true; isNormalUser = true;
extraGroups = [ "wheel" "docker" ]; # Enable sudo for the user. extraGroups = [ "dialout" "wheel" "docker" "libvirtd" ]; # Enable sudo for the user.
}; };
# List packages installed in system profile. # List packages installed in system profile.
@ -67,28 +67,34 @@
# Enable modules # Enable modules
modules = { modules = {
desktop = { desktop = {
#sway.enable = true; sway.enable = false;
}; };
devel = { devel = {
#engineering.enable = true; engineering.enable = false;
notes.enable = true; notes.enable = true;
#python.enable = true; python.enable = false;
#tooling.enable = true; tooling.enable = false;
}; };
gaming = { gaming = {
steam.enable = true; steam.enable = true;
}; };
services = { services = {
#jellyfin.enable = true; jellyfin.enable = false;
#peripherals.enable = true; peripherals.enable = false;
samba-client.enable = true; samba-client.enable = true;
#samba-server.enable = true;
syncthing.enable = true; syncthing.enable = true;
#virt-manager.enable = true; virt-manager.enable = false;
}; };
system = { system = {
ssh.enable = true; ssh.enable = true;
terminal.enable = true; terminal.enable = true;
wireguard-client = {
enable = true;
privateKeyFile = "/home/${user}/.wireguard/bulwark";
address = [ "192.168.2.4/24" ];
publicKey = "bd7bbZOngl/FTdBlnbIhgCLNf6yx5X8WjiRB7E1NEQQ=";
endpoint = "66.218.43.87";
};
}; };
}; };
# Did you read the comment? # Did you read the comment?